>I would like to suggest that maintenance of an issue tracker for WGs be
>added to the Statement of Work.
>
>Many IETF WG are currently using an issue tracker. There is quite a bit
>of diversity in the software being used. While many WGs might continue to
>desire to use their own trackers, I do think it would be very useful for
>the Secretariat to maintain one tracker that could be available to any WG
>that wanted it. That way a WG desiring to use a tracker would not have to
>host and maintain their own tracker.
>
>I would consider this item to be higher priority than even existing items
>such as Jabber, since if handled well it could improve the ability of WGs
>to manage their work.
>
I agree. Issue trackers, if properly used -- and that's a non-trivial
qualifier! -- are a big aid to WGs.
